What does the word "Drongos" mean?

The word "drongos" is a term that may initially confuse many, as it can refer to different contexts depending on where it is used. Most commonly recognized in the realms of birdwatching and Australian slang, the term has distinct meanings worthy of exploration.

In ornithology, "drongo" designates a family of birds belonging to the genus Dicrurus. These birds are recognized for their glossy plumage, acrobatic flying abilities, and distinctive forked tails. Drongos are typically found in tropical and subtropical regions across Africa, Asia, and Australia. Their unique characteristics and behaviors provide an interesting subject for bird enthusiasts. On the other hand, in Australian slang, "drongo" has evolved into a colloquial term used to describe someone who is foolish or incompetent. This usage has interesting historical roots. The term is believed to have originated from the name of a racehorse that failed in competitions during the 1920s. Over time, it transitioned into everyday language as a way to poke fun at someone’s misjudgments or inept behaviors, creating a colorful addition to the Australian vernacular.

Despite its negative connotations in slang, the term "drongo" reflects a certain playful humor in Australian culture. Using this word can convey more than the simple act of calling someone foolish; it often carries with it an air of camaraderie and light-hearted teasing within social interactions.
